My partner and I decided to try this restaurant the other week which has quite a renowned reputation.The restaurant inside is quite fancy and contemporary. Very nicely decorated.We couldn't fault the staff either who were very polite and friendly........The main attraction........ The food....... I can only say it was below par that night. (We've never been before so perhaps a one off?) The prawn linguine resembled a packet of supernoodles in a watery rue sauce with a few peas on top. The pizza was quite sloppy and anaemic looking. Not something we would expect for an Italian eatery.We have tried a few other outstanding Italian restaurants in the area which are leaps and bounds in front of this one.
